Abstract
The electrochemical oxidation of halides and reduction of halogens have been studied in sulfolane, an aprotic solvent. Stable trihalide ions X3− are formed. The formation constants K of these X3− ions have been determined by potentiometry as 107.4 (X = I), 106.8 (X = Br), and 1031(X = Cl) in a 0.1 M LiClO4 medium. The values of the constants K have also been obtained in methanol, a hydroxylic solvent, 104.2 (X = I), 102.3 (X = Br), and in mixtures of both solvents (X = I).
